Bonjour,

Mon problème est le suivant: je voudrai lancer une image de chargement lorsqu'un utilisateur valide le remplissage d'un rapport et je bloque au niveau de l'ajax je sais pas pour insérer mon image de chargement ainsi que son lancement pour au final afficher la liste des rapport lorsqu'il a finis son chargement.

Merci pour votre aide.

Voici le code:


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
$.ajax({
	type: "POST",
	url: "rapport_ajouter_vide.php",
	contentType: "application/x-www-form-urlencoded;charset=UTF-8",
	beforeSend: function () {
		$(".ui-dialog-buttonpane").find('button:contains("Valider")').prop("disabled", true);
	},
	data: {pdate:date, pheure:heure, pfin:fin, ptemps:temps, pid_client:id_client, ptype:type, pid_contact:id_contact, 
		pnuit:nuit, pcommande:commande, pmontant:montant, pkm_depart:km_depart, pkm_arrivee:km_arrivee, pkm:km, paction:action, 
		prendu:rendu, pkm_domicile:km_domicile, pprospect:prospect, pnom_prospect:nom_prospect}
	}).done(function(result) {
		if (result != ""){
			$('#erreur_rapport').html(result);
			$(".ui-dialog-buttonpane").find('button:contains("Valider")').prop("disabled", false);
		}
		else
			liste_rapport();
});